Job Description
GUY’s Tulsa office is seeking a Field Data Collection Technician who will be responsible for supervised collection of general civil engineering field data related to surveying, right of way, subsurface utility engineering, and bridge inspections.

Essential Roles and Responsibilities
- Assist in performing surveys for county roads, bridges, debris basins, buildings, and other properties.
- Assist with supervised subsurface utility locating.
- Assist with identifying existing utility facilities in the field.
- Assist in performing bridge inspections per FHWA requirements.
- Act as chain-man or rod-man.
- Read, understand, interpret, and communicate the general elements of highway construction, right-of-way plans, and bridge inspection reports.
- Take legible notes.
- Keep clear and detailed records of meetings, take appropriate and clear photos and corresponding documentation, draft bridge sketches, and generate professional, detailed reports and correspondence.
- Responsible for maintenance of trucks and general non-technical equipment.
- Responsible for loading and unloading equipment, ensuring equipment is left to charge overnight, and stocking trucks daily.
